    Frankincense Benefits and Uses: A Complete Guide to This Ancient Remedy

    By AdminNovember 26, 202512 Mins Read

    Frankincense has been treasured for thousands of years, not just for its aromatic properties but also for its potential health benefits. This ancient resin, derived from the Boswellia tree, continues to capture the attention of modern researchers investigating its therapeutic properties. From supporting joint health to potentially fighting inflammation, frankincense offers a range of wellness applications backed by both traditional use and emerging scientific evidence.

    What Is Frankincense?

    Frankincense, scientifically known as olibanum, is a fragrant resin obtained from trees belonging to the Boswellia genus. These trees predominantly grow in arid, mountainous regions across India, the Middle East, and various parts of Africa, particularly Somalia and Ethiopia.

    The resin is harvested by making small incisions in the bark of the Boswellia tree, allowing the milky-white sap to seep out. This sap hardens into tear-shaped droplets that are then collected and processed. The resulting resin has a distinctive woody, slightly spicy aroma that has made it valuable in religious ceremonies, perfumery, and traditional medicine for millennia.

    Today, frankincense is available in several forms: as raw resin for burning, essential oil for aromatherapy and topical applications, and standardized extracts in capsules or tablets for oral supplementation.

    The Active Compounds in Frankincense

    The therapeutic properties of frankincense are primarily attributed to compounds called boswellic acids, which are pentacyclic triterpenic acids. These bioactive substances, along with other components like terpenes, are responsible for most of the resin’s anti-inflammatory and medicinal effects.

    Research indicates that boswellic acids work by inhibiting specific enzymes involved in inflammatory processes, particularly 5-lipoxygenase, which plays a key role in producing pro-inflammatory leukotrienes. This mechanism of action makes frankincense particularly interesting for conditions characterized by chronic inflammation.

    Science-Backed Benefits of Frankincense

    Supporting Joint Health and Arthritis Relief

    One of the most well-researched applications of frankincense is its potential to help manage arthritis symptoms. The anti-inflammatory properties of boswellic acids may help reduce joint pain, stiffness, and swelling associated with both osteoarthritis and rheumatoid arthritis.

    Multiple studies have examined frankincense extract supplementation in people with knee osteoarthritis. Research participants taking Boswellia extract have reported improvements in pain levels, physical function, and joint mobility compared to placebo groups. Some studies have used doses ranging from 100 mg to 500 mg of standardized extract taken one to three times daily over periods of several weeks to months.

    Topical applications of frankincense oil may also provide relief when applied directly to affected joints. The combination of internal supplementation and external application might offer synergistic benefits, though more research is needed to confirm optimal protocols.

    Importantly, while frankincense shows promise for arthritis management, it should be viewed as a complementary approach rather than a replacement for conventional treatment. Anyone considering frankincense for arthritis should consult with their healthcare provider to ensure it fits appropriately into their overall treatment plan.

    Promoting Digestive Health

    Frankincense has demonstrated potential benefits for various digestive conditions, particularly those involving inflammation of the gastrointestinal tract.

    For individuals with irritable bowel syndrome (IBS), frankincense supplementation has been associated with reduced abdominal discomfort, bloating, and improved bowel habits. The anti-inflammatory and antispasmodic properties of the resin may help calm an overactive digestive system.

    Perhaps more significantly, research suggests that frankincense may be beneficial for people with inflammatory bowel diseases such as ulcerative colitis and Crohn’s disease. Studies have shown that Boswellia extract can help reduce inflammation in the intestinal lining, potentially leading to symptom improvement and extended periods of remission.

    In one notable study, participants with ulcerative colitis in remission who took Boswellia extract experienced fewer relapses compared to a control group. The extract appeared to help maintain the integrity of the intestinal barrier and modulate inflammatory responses.

    As with any supplement used for digestive conditions, it’s essential to work with a healthcare provider to ensure frankincense is appropriate for your specific situation and won’t interfere with other treatments.

    Respiratory Support and Asthma Management

    Traditional medicine systems have long used frankincense to support respiratory health, and modern research is beginning to validate these historical uses. The same anti-inflammatory mechanisms that benefit joints and digestion may also help with respiratory conditions.

    For people with asthma, frankincense may help reduce the frequency and severity of symptoms. The boswellic acids in frankincense appear to inhibit the production of leukotrienes that cause bronchial constriction and inflammation in the airways.

    Some studies have found that people with asthma who supplemented with frankincense extract alongside their standard medications experienced improvements in lung function, reduced wheezing, and decreased use of rescue inhalers. However, frankincense should never replace prescribed asthma medications without explicit guidance from a healthcare provider.

    The resin may also provide benefits for other respiratory conditions characterized by inflammation, such as chronic bronchitis, though more research is needed in these areas.

    Oral Health Applications

    The antibacterial properties of frankincense make it a promising natural agent for promoting oral health. Boswellic acids have shown effectiveness against various bacteria that contribute to tooth decay, gum disease, and bad breath.

    Research has demonstrated that frankincense extract can combat bacteria associated with aggressive periodontitis and gingivitis. Some studies have tested frankincense-containing chewing gum and found that it helps reduce bacterial counts in saliva.

    While frankincense shows potential as an adjunct to regular oral hygiene practices, it shouldn’t replace brushing, flossing, and professional dental care. Some natural toothpastes and mouthwashes now include frankincense extract as an active ingredient.

    Potential Anticancer Properties

    Perhaps one of the most exciting areas of frankincense research involves its potential anticancer properties. Laboratory studies have shown that boswellic acids may inhibit cancer cell proliferation and induce apoptosis (programmed cell death) in various cancer cell lines.

    Test-tube and animal studies have investigated frankincense’s effects on breast, prostate, colon, pancreatic, and skin cancers, among others. The mechanisms appear to involve multiple pathways, including inhibition of cancer cell DNA synthesis and interference with cell signaling that promotes tumor growth.

    Some research has also explored frankincense’s potential to reduce side effects of conventional cancer treatments. For instance, studies examining brain tumor patients found that high doses of boswellic acid extract helped reduce cerebral edema (brain swelling) that can occur as a side effect of radiation therapy.

    It’s crucial to emphasize that while these preliminary findings are promising, frankincense is not a proven cancer treatment. Anyone dealing with cancer should rely on evidence-based medical treatments and only consider frankincense as a complementary approach under the guidance of their oncology team.

    How to Use Frankincense

    Frankincense Essential Oil

    Frankincense essential oil is one of the most popular forms for home use. It can be employed in several ways:

    Aromatherapy: Add a few drops to a diffuser to disperse the aromatic compounds throughout a room. Many people find the scent calming and grounding.

    Topical Application: Always dilute frankincense essential oil in a carrier oil (such as coconut, jojoba, or sweet almond oil) before applying to skin. A typical dilution is 2-3 drops of essential oil per teaspoon of carrier oil. This can be massaged into joints, applied to the chest for respiratory support, or used in skincare routines.

    Bath Additive: Mix a few drops with a carrier oil or bath salts before adding to bathwater.

    Never ingest essential oils unless under the guidance of a qualified healthcare practitioner, as they are highly concentrated and can be harmful if consumed improperly.

    Frankincense Supplements

    Standardized frankincense extracts are available in capsule or tablet form for internal use. These supplements typically contain measured amounts of boswellic acids, allowing for consistent dosing.

    Dosages used in research studies have varied widely depending on the condition being addressed, ranging from 100 mg to 1,500 mg or more per day, often divided into multiple doses. The optimal dosage for any individual depends on various factors including the specific health goal, body weight, and overall health status.

    It’s advisable to start with lower doses and gradually increase as tolerated, always following product instructions or healthcare provider recommendations.

    Frankincense Resin

    The raw resin can be burned as incense for aromatherapy purposes or, in some traditional practices, small pieces are chewed or dissolved in water for internal use. However, supplements offer more standardized and convenient dosing for therapeutic purposes.

    Safety Considerations and Potential Side Effects

    Frankincense is generally considered safe for most people when used appropriately. Its long history of traditional use and relatively low toxicity profile make it a well-tolerated natural remedy.

    Common Side Effects

    When side effects do occur, they are typically mild and may include:

    • Digestive upset, including nausea or acid reflux
    • Diarrhea or constipation
    • Skin irritation when applied topically (especially if not properly diluted)
    • Headache

    Who Should Avoid Frankincense

    Pregnant and Breastfeeding Women: Some evidence suggests that frankincense may increase the risk of miscarriage. Pregnant women and those trying to conceive should avoid frankincense supplements. The safety during breastfeeding has not been adequately studied.

    People Taking Certain Medications: Frankincense may interact with several types of medications, including blood thinners like warfarin and anti-inflammatory drugs. It may also affect how the liver processes certain medications.

    Those with Upcoming Surgery: Due to potential effects on blood clotting, it’s recommended to stop taking frankincense supplements at least two weeks before scheduled surgery.

    Quality and Purity Concerns

    Not all frankincense products are created equal. Quality can vary significantly between brands and sources. When selecting frankincense products:

    • Look for reputable brands that provide third-party testing results
    • Check for standardized boswellic acid content in supplements
    • Ensure essential oils are pure and not diluted with synthetic fragrances
    • Verify the botanical source (specific Boswellia species)

    What the Research Doesn’t Support

    Despite its many potential benefits, frankincense is sometimes marketed for uses that lack solid scientific backing. It’s important to distinguish between evidence-based applications and unproven claims.

    Blood Sugar Control

    While some preliminary animal studies and small human trials have suggested that frankincense might help regulate blood sugar levels, the evidence remains inconsistent and insufficient. People with diabetes should not rely on frankincense for blood sugar management and must continue with their prescribed treatment plans.

    Mental Health Benefits

    Although frankincense aromatherapy is often promoted for reducing stress and anxiety, and some animal studies have shown potential effects on mood-regulating neurotransmitters, human clinical trials are lacking. While many people find the aroma pleasant and relaxing, this doesn’t constitute evidence for treating clinical anxiety or depression.

    Memory Enhancement

    Some animal research has indicated that frankincense compounds might support cognitive function and memory, but these findings haven’t been replicated in human studies. Claims about memory improvement or protection against cognitive decline remain speculative.

    Hormonal Balance and Fertility

    Despite traditional uses and marketing claims suggesting that frankincense can regulate hormones, ease menopausal symptoms, or enhance fertility, scientific evidence supporting these uses is minimal. Anyone experiencing hormonal issues or fertility challenges should seek guidance from appropriate medical specialists.

    Choosing Quality Frankincense Products

    To maximize potential benefits and ensure safety, selecting high-quality frankincense products is essential.

    For essential oils, look for oils labeled as “therapeutic grade” from reputable companies that provide Gas Chromatography-Mass Spectrometry (GC-MS) test results. These tests verify the chemical composition and purity of the oil. The botanical name (such as Boswellia sacra, Boswellia carterii, or Boswellia serrata) should be clearly stated.

    For supplements, choose products that specify the percentage of boswellic acids they contain. Research studies typically use extracts standardized to contain 30-65% boswellic acids. Products should also be manufactured according to Good Manufacturing Practices (GMP) and ideally tested by independent third parties for purity and potency.

    Frequently Asked Questions About Frankincense

    What does frankincense smell like?

    Frankincense has a complex aroma often described as woody, earthy, and slightly spicy with subtle citrus notes. Many people find it warm, calming, and meditative. The exact scent can vary depending on the Boswellia species and region of origin.

    How long does it take for frankincense to work?

    The timeframe varies depending on the condition being addressed and the form of frankincense used. Aromatherapy effects are typically immediate, while benefits for conditions like arthritis may require several weeks of consistent use. Most studies examining frankincense for chronic conditions used treatment periods of 4-12 weeks.

    Can I take frankincense every day?

    For most people, daily use of frankincense supplements or essential oil appears safe when used appropriately and at recommended doses. However, it’s wise to consult with a healthcare provider before beginning any long-term supplementation regimen.

    Is frankincense the same as myrrh?

    No, although they are often mentioned together and share some characteristics. Both are aromatic resins used historically in religious and medicinal contexts, but they come from different plant genera and have distinct chemical compositions and properties.

    What is the best form of frankincense for joint pain?

    For joint pain, oral supplements containing standardized Boswellia extract (with specified boswellic acid content) have the most research support. Some people also find topical application of diluted frankincense essential oil helpful as a complementary approach.

    The Bottom Line

    Frankincense represents a fascinating bridge between ancient healing traditions and modern scientific investigation. Its anti-inflammatory properties, primarily attributed to boswellic acids, show genuine promise for supporting joint health, digestive wellness, respiratory function, and potentially other conditions.

    The strongest evidence supports using frankincense for arthritis-related symptoms and certain inflammatory digestive conditions. Emerging research on its potential anticancer properties is exciting but remains preliminary, requiring much more study before definitive conclusions can be drawn.

    While frankincense is generally safe for most people, it’s not appropriate for everyone, particularly pregnant women and those taking certain medications. As with any natural remedy or supplement, quality matters significantly, and professional guidance is invaluable.
